Summary: <p>Welcome to Get Up in the Cool: Old Time Music with Cameron DeWhitt and Friends. This week’s and next week’s friend is Alan Kaufman! Also joining us is Don Stratton on guitar, who will be featured in his own episode in the near future. Alan is a tunesmith and a songsmith; while most of us make withdrawals from the traditional music bank, Alan makes regular deposits. This week’s episode is dedicated to his original fiddle tunes and next week we’ll play and sing his original songs. Alan possesses that rare combination of whimsy and thoughtfulness necessary to make the perfect neo-traditional tune. If you play Old Time, maybe try to learn a few from this episode.
